Middlesbrough Defeat Keeps City 16th

Last updated : 19 April 2011 By Covsupport News Service

Coventry City remain in sixteenth place in the Championship after Middlesbrough were beaten 3-1 at Burnley tonight.

Tony Mowbray's side, who face the Sky Blues on Monday at the Riverside Stadium, would have gone above City had they won but first half goals from Rodriquez, Elliott and Duff put Burnley 3-0 up.

Taylor scored a consolation goal in the 81st minute.
